Audi have dumped a large number of RS3's in the UK from the unsold production as there is a face lift A3 out.

So there should be discounts to be had, with dealers you will only get money off the car or an over book for your car or a combo of both, but there is a fixed amount they will discount a car. If the RS3 is with Audi the S3 may have a little more value to them as it is a car they would show rather than auction.

Check with WBAC type sites to find out what you car is actually worth trade and work from there, my friend got 10% of his dealer spec'd RS3 so i would be aiming for 5k off list, or 5k over book for the S3 or a mix of the two that gave 5k

Good luck with this, I don't believe Auto Trader prices when I trade my cars in, they're priced in favour of sellers and v few dealers will match the price of Auto Trader. I can't remember the price company Audi use but it's always less than you'd want hence why you have to haggle on both sides of the deal.
 
If I was you I would sell the S3 privately then walk into a dealership with an unregistered RS3 with a spec you want and tell them you want 9% discount and and you'll sign the dotted line.
It worked for me! ( I actually got 9.5%).
